It seems that no one mentioned the Real Player Enterprise Edition, it's
standalone and free, you just cant manage it with out the paid for
manager.
Has any one tried to play around with this one at all, the only real
issue I can see is that because you cant control it's behaviour it
scoops up all the file associations that it wants. I can see how we
could "sort" it by putting it in an desktop image and then configuring
it as we want and that then goes through Ghost or some such scenario but
it would be nice to be able to deploy centrally and not have to tinker
too much in an image, if that makes sense.
